What is Covered Under Japan Carbon Capture Storage Market

The Japan Carbon Capture Storage Market encompasses technologies and infrastructure used to capture carbon dioxide emissions from industrial facilities and power generation plants, transport the captured carbon, and securely store it underground. The market serves sectors such as power generation, cement, oil & gas, and metal production. Growing carbon neutrality commitments, industrial emissions reduction targets, and investments in clean energy infrastructure are strengthening the adoption of carbon capture and storage solutions across Japan.

What is the Japan Carbon Capture Storage Market Size, and Growth Rate

The Japan Carbon Capture Storage Market was valued at USD 113.72 million in 2026 and is projected to reach USD 224.94 million by 2034, registering a CAGR of 8.90% during the forecast period. Market expansion is being supported by rising industrial decarbonization initiatives, increasing deployment of carbon management technologies, and government-backed climate policies focused on achieving net-zero emissions.

Industries across Japan are investing in advanced carbon capture technologies to comply with sustainability regulations while reducing environmental impact. Collaborations among energy companies, industrial operators, and technology providers are accelerating project development and expanding the commercialization of carbon capture and storage solutions throughout the country.

How is the Japan Carbon Capture Storage Market Segment

By Application

• Power Generation – 41%

• Cement – 24%

• Oil & Gas

• Metal Production

• Others

Power generation represents the largest revenue-generating application segment, accounting for approximately 41% of the market in 2026. The dominance of this segment is attributed to significant carbon emissions from thermal power facilities and increasing regulatory pressure to reduce greenhouse gas emissions. Utilities are increasingly deploying carbon capture and storage systems to support clean energy transition goals and improve environmental compliance.

The cement segment holds nearly 24% market share due to the carbon-intensive nature of cement manufacturing. As sustainable construction practices gain momentum, manufacturers are investing in carbon reduction technologies to align with environmental objectives. Meanwhile, oil & gas, metal production, and other industrial sectors continue adopting carbon capture solutions to improve operational sustainability and support long-term decarbonization strategies. These developments are contributing significantly to market revenue growth across application categories.

By Technology

• Post Combustion – 45%

• Industrial Process – 23%

• Pre-Combustion

• Oxy-Combustion

Post-combustion technology dominates the Japan Carbon Capture Storage Market with approximately 45% market share in 2026. Its leadership position is primarily driven by compatibility with existing industrial facilities and power generation infrastructure. Organizations prefer post-combustion systems because they can be integrated into operational environments with relatively lower disruption and have demonstrated commercial viability across multiple industries.

Industrial process technologies account for nearly 23% market share, supported by increasing implementation in manufacturing operations seeking emissions reduction. Pre-combustion and oxy-combustion technologies are also gaining traction through innovation initiatives and pilot projects. Continuous technological advancements, coupled with growing demand for efficient carbon management systems, are expected to enhance the adoption of various carbon capture technologies across industrial sectors during the forecast period.

Regional Projection of Japan Carbon Capture Storage Market

• Kanto – 39%

• Kansai – 27%

• Chubu – 21%

• Rest of Japan – 13%

Kanto leads the market with approximately 39% share due to its concentration of industrial facilities, energy infrastructure, and advanced technology centers. Strong government support and industrial decarbonization programs further reinforce regional growth.

Kansai is experiencing notable expansion driven by manufacturing modernization and carbon reduction initiatives. Chubu continues to benefit from industrial emissions management efforts and clean technology deployment. The Rest of Japan is witnessing steady growth supported by environmental infrastructure investments and the ongoing transition toward sustainable energy systems.
